If you are looking for information on the animal, National Geographic and Saint Louis Zoo highlight its reputation as one of the world's deadliest reptiles.
Characteristics: It can reach up to 14 feet in length and move at speeds of 12 mph.
Toxicity: Without antivenom, the fatality rate from a bite is 100%, often occurring within hours.
Behavior: While often called aggressive, experts like those on Facebook's wildlife videos note that they are primarily "nervous" and only strike when they feel trapped or threatened.

In Cyberpunk 2077, the Black Mamba is a legendary piece of Circulatory System Cyberware.
Damage Multiplier: It significantly boosts all damage dealt to enemies who are already poisoned.
Synergy: It works exceptionally well with Toxic Grenades and the Contagion quickhack, especially when combined with fire damage to trigger massive explosions.
